蓝桥杯历届试题-最大子阵 (C++代码) 摘要:#include<cstdio> #define maxn 520 long long n,m,sum[maxn][maxn],max; int main(void) { scanf("%…… 题解列表 2018年04月07日 1 点赞 0 评论 1821 浏览 评分:8.5
蓝桥杯历届试题-最大子阵 (C语言代码)---------------C语言——菜鸟级 摘要:解题思路: 行的前缀和(对行区间求和) + 最大子段原理 (对列区间求和)注意事项:参考代码:#include<stdio.h> #include<string.h> int main() { …… 题解列表 2018年05月16日 3 点赞 6 评论 1468 浏览 评分:9.0
蓝桥杯历届试题-最大子阵 (C++代码) 摘要:解题思路: 二维压缩成一维的最大子段,枚举。参考代码:#include<bits/stdc++.h> #define Inf 0x3F3F3F3F using namespace s…… 题解列表 2018年07月30日 0 点赞 0 评论 787 浏览 评分:0.0
蓝桥杯历届试题-最大子阵 (C++代码) 摘要:解题思路:即便是使用了dp,复杂度依然是O(nm²),在一些优化技巧的帮助下,勉强可以承受最大为500的数据规模的打击,时间在700ms上下注意事项:优化:不要用算法模板里的max,直接用三目运算符或…… 题解列表 2018年11月07日 0 点赞 1 评论 654 浏览 评分:0.0
蓝桥杯历届试题-最大子阵-题解(Java代码) 摘要:91%错误 求大神指导这是为什么 结果也是和题目的结果一样 ```java Scanner scanner=new Scanner(System.in); int a=scanner.n…… 题解列表 2020年02月15日 0 点赞 2 评论 534 浏览 评分:0.0
优质题解 蓝桥杯历届试题-最大子阵-题解(C语言代码)---dp最大子段和思想(详细) 摘要:解题思路: ###### //建议边看代码边看思路// 1.如果单纯枚举首行,末行,首列,末列来做这道题,就是四重循环,数据最大时,每重循环大概500次,500^4时间复杂度可以达到十的十次方,肯…… 题解列表 2020年03月26日 0 点赞 6 评论 2289 浏览 评分:9.8
蓝桥杯历届试题-最大子阵-题解(C++代码) 摘要:```cpp #include using namespace std; int main() { int n,a[505][505],m,temp,sum=-0x3f3f3f3f;…… 题解列表 2020年09月02日 0 点赞 2 评论 812 浏览 评分:8.7
蓝桥杯历届试题-最大子阵-巧将问题转换成最大子数组(Java实现) 摘要:解题思路:每一次都将单行或多行的数据加起来形成一行,就可以转换成最大子数组问题,而最大子数组是比较简单的,直接一层循环进行累加,如果之前累加的和小于0,那么就丢弃,从下一个点重新开始计算,否则就可以加…… 题解列表 2021年02月21日 0 点赞 0 评论 458 浏览 评分:9.9
参考最大子序列和前缀和 采用dp思路清晰易懂 摘要:解题思路:注意事项:参考代码:import java.util.Arrays;import java.util.Scanner;public class Main { static int n;…… 题解列表 2022年02月15日 0 点赞 0 评论 331 浏览 评分:9.9
超短的C++代码(附详细解题思路) 摘要:解题思路:①如果按照对每行每列的数字进行逐一分析,很容易就超限,500可不是个小数哦~~~②那就想怎么能通过加减运算去节省时间,不难想到相邻的行之间相加就可以得到一个子阵,所以,对输入的数据加上前面所…… 题解列表 2022年03月11日 0 点赞 1 评论 375 浏览 评分:7.1